Key Insights
- The transformation of semantic search integrates advanced NLP techniques, enhancing the accuracy of content discovery.
- Deployment of language models requires careful evaluation metrics for success, such as latency and factuality, to ensure reliability.
- Data provenance and licensing challenges present significant risks for organizations implementing AI-driven search solutions.
- Real-world applications of semantic search span diverse sectors, impacting everything from content creation to customer service.
- Understanding trade-offs, including potential hallucinations and compliance issues, is crucial for successful deployment of NLP technologies.
How Semantic Search is Revolutionizing AI Content Discovery
The evolving role of semantic search in AI-driven content discovery is reshaping how users interact with information. This shift emphasizes the significance of context and understanding within search algorithms, moving beyond traditional keyword matching. With the integration of advanced natural language processing (NLP), semantic search is crucial for various stakeholders, from content creators seeking to enhance their visibility to developers building robust AI applications. As businesses increasingly rely on intelligent content discovery mechanisms, understanding the technical underpinnings and deployment challenges becomes essential for effectively leveraging this transformative technology. For instance, a small business aiming to optimize customer queries will benefit immensely from a semantic search approach that accurately interprets user intent, allowing for enriched user experiences and improved engagement.
Why This Matters
Understanding Semantic Search
Semantic search refers to a search technology that improves search accuracy by understanding user intent and the contextual meaning of terms. Unlike traditional keyword search methods, semantic search leverages advanced NLP techniques, such as embedding models, to comprehend the relationships and nuances within language.
This advancement enables users to discover content that is more relevant to their needs, thereby enhancing information retrieval processes. For example, a user searching for “best budget laptops for students” would receive results that consider not just the keywords, but also the context of budget constraints and suitability for students.
Technical Core: NLP Techniques in Semantic Search
The heart of semantic search lies in sophisticated NLP techniques, including the utilization of embeddings, which represent words in vector space. This allows for capturing semantic relationships and contextual meanings. Models like BERT or GPT significantly enhance the understanding of language, enabling systems to interpret queries with greater accuracy.
Furthermore, retrievable-augmented generation (RAG) combines large language models with information retrieval frameworks, allowing for the generation of responses that incorporate both synthesized knowledge and factual content from external sources, thereby enriching user interactions.
Evidence and Evaluation
Success in deploying semantic search is measured through robust evaluation metrics. Key metrics include latency, accuracy of results, and user satisfaction. Human evaluation remains critical, as it helps assess the effectiveness of language models in understanding queries and providing relevant results.
Benchmarks like BLEU and ROUGE provide quantitative assessment frameworks, while qualitative measures, such as user studies, offer insights into the model’s practical impact on user experience.
Data and Rights: Challenges Ahead
As organizations implement semantic search technologies, data provenance and copyright issues emerge as critical concerns. Licensing agreements must be thoroughly evaluated to mitigate risks associated with intellectual property. Utilizing quality datasets that respect privacy regulations is paramount to ensure ethical AI deployment.
Moreover, the handling of personally identifiable information (PII) within search queries necessitates stringent adherence to data privacy laws, including GDPR. Organizations must establish clear guidelines for data usage to protect user rights and maintain compliance.
Deployment Reality: Cost and Monitoring
Implementing semantic search involves not just technical deployment but also considerations of cost and resource allocation. The inference costs of large language models can be significant, particularly when scaling applications for broad user bases.
Monitoring becomes essential to ensure the ongoing effectiveness of the deployment. This includes tracking model drift and performance over time, as well as establishing guardrails against potential exploitation, such as prompt injections that can compromise system integrity.
Practical Applications Across Domains
The implications of semantic search extend across various sectors. In the tech domain, developers can leverage APIs to facilitate seamless integration of search functionalities into applications. This empowers companies to deliver tailored content to their users, enhancing satisfaction.
For non-technical auditors, such as small business owners, semantic search can optimize customer queries, allowing for more intuitive user interactions and improved service delivery. Another example is in education, where students can access relevant resources more efficiently, enhancing their learning experiences.
Trade-offs and Failure Modes
Despite its advantages, the implementation of semantic search is not without risks. Hallucinations, where models produce inaccurate information, can undermine user trust. Furthermore, ethical considerations around safety, compliance, and data security are pivotal for successful deployment.
User experience may also falter if the system fails to meet expectations, resulting in hidden costs associated with customer dissatisfaction. Understanding these failure modes is essential for devising effective mitigation strategies.
Ecosystem Context: Standards and Initiatives
The landscape of semantic search is also shaped by evolving standards and frameworks contributing to responsible AI development. Initiatives like the NIST AI Risk Management Framework provide essential guidelines for organizations navigating compliance and developing ethically aligned AI technologies. Additionally, the implementation of model cards and dataset documentation can enhance transparency around model capabilities and limitations.
What Comes Next
- Keep an eye on ongoing research in language understanding to identify emerging technologies and methodologies.
- Evaluate the implications of data regulations as they evolve, particularly in relation to AI technology deployment.
- Conduct pilot projects that test the effectiveness of semantic search implementations across different industries.
- Engage in community discussions to stay informed about best practices and standards in AI-driven content discovery.
Sources
- NIST AI Risk Management Framework ✔ Verified
- The BERT Model Paper ● Derived
- Forbes on Semantic Search ○ Assumption
